TOPIC: Grammar
Your task : Nouns in context
The ending of a noun may tell how many, or whether the noun is
singular or plural.
Some nouns add -s when they become plural. Nouns that end in s, x, z,
ch, or sh add -es. Nouns that end in a consonant and y change the y to i
and add -es.
Plural
Singular
(more than one person, place,
(one person, place, or thing)
or thing)
comet comets
box boxes
pony ponies
